## Deployment Notes: Image Cache Leak

For the weekly sync: the Pemberly thumbnail service has been leaking memory in its in-process image cache since the 4.2 rollout. Evictions stop firing once the LRU index exceeds its soft cap, so resident memory climbs roughly 300 MB per hour under normal load. We're shipping a patched build tonight with stricter eviction and a hard ceiling, plus a restart cron as a stopgap. Deploy order is canary, then the Dunmore cluster. The settings we're deploying with are as follows.

config for haweg-bagag:
[kasath]
host = kasath.qirvancorp.internal
user = kasath_svc
database = kasath_prod

## Build Provenance — LiftPath Simulator

Every LiftPath elevator-dispatch simulator release is built on the Corvane hermetic runners from a tagged commit, with all third-party models vendored and checksummed. The release manager must verify the attestation bundle before promotion to the Ardenfall distribution bucket; unsigned artifacts are rejected automatically. For promotion, record the attested build token below.

trace token, fafog-kageg: htk4_98e6

Ticket: Snapshot config drift between CI and local runs

Hey folks — we've noticed the Fernbright snapshot tests for UI components pass locally but fail in CI, and it turns out the renderer config drifted between the two. Plugin authors: if your snapshots suddenly churn, this is probably why, not your code. We're pinning the canonical settings so everyone renders against the same baseline. Until the fix ships, compare your local setup against the authoritative values below.

deployment values, yahag-tawef:
ZORWYN_HOST=zorwyn.tolvaqlabs.internal
ZORWYN_PORT=9300

Runbook — shipping a PrintHerd plugin. Quick recap for plugin authors: build against the v3 spooler SDK, run the conformance suite, then package as a .phx bundle. The spooler refuses to load anything unsigned, so don't bother uploading raw bundles — they'll just sit in quarantine. Sign with the partner key issued for your org, and double-check the fingerprint matches what's printed in your onboarding sheet. For reference, the current partner signing key is shown below.

signing key of baduf-taweg = bky6_Zf7bem